Night Terrors as Prodromal Symptom of Obstructive Sleep Apnoea‐Induced Arrhythmia: A Case Report
We report a patient experiencing episodes of night terrors who, after 24‐h ECG monitoring and polysomnography, was diagnosed with obstructive sleep apnoea‐induced atrioventricular block.
